The Government of the Autonomous Region of Madeira has updated the price lists for services provided by CARAM - Autonomous Region of Madeira Slaughter Center, EPERAM. The update reflects a 3.33% coefficient, corresponding to the variation in the consumer price index (excluding housing) recorded in the previous year.
The changes were formalized through two separate legal acts:
Both ordinances entered into force the day after their publication in the Official Journal, on April 1, 2026, and include detailed tables for various species, such as cattle, pigs, sheep, goats, equines, and rabbits, covering services for slaughter, carcass preparation, transport, and vehicle washing.
